Built-in cabinetry staining services involve applying a fresh, high-quality stain to existing or newly installed built-in furniture and storage units. This process enhances the natural beauty of wood surfaces by highlighting grain patterns and adding depth to the finish. Staining can be customized to match the surrounding decor or to create a specific aesthetic, whether that’s a classic, modern, or rustic look. Skilled service providers use precise techniques to ensure an even application, resulting in a smooth, professional appearance that revitalizes the entire space.
Many homeowners turn to cabinet staining to address common problems such as worn, faded, or outdated finishes that no longer reflect their style. Over time, exposure to sunlight, cleaning, and general wear can cause finishes to deteriorate, leaving cabinets looking dull or chipped. Staining provides an effective solution by refreshing the appearance without the need for complete replacement. It can also help conceal minor imperfections in the wood surface, giving cabinets a uniform look and extending their lifespan.

The overview below groups typical Built In Cabinetry Staining proj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Monticello, MN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Cabinet Touch-Ups - Typically range from $250-$600 for many routine staining jobs on individual cabinets or small kitchen sections. Most projects in this category fall within this middle range, with fewer reaching the higher end for more detailed work.
Medium-Scale Cabinet Staining - Costs usually fall between $600-$1,500 for larger kitchens or multiple rooms requiring staining. Many local contractors handle these projects within this range, though complexity can push prices higher.
Larger, Complex Projects - Larger or more intricate staining jobs, such as extensive cabinetry or custom finishes, can range from $1,500-$3,500. These projects are less common but may include detailed woodwork or multiple finishes.
Full Cabinet Re-Staining or Replacement - Complete overhauls or replacement projects can reach $3,500 and above, with larger, more elaborate projects potentially exceeding $5,000. Such projects are typically reserved for extensive renovations or premium finishes.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in staining built-in cabinetry? Staining built-in cabinetry typically includes preparing the surface, applying a stain to enhance the wood's appearance, and finishing with a protective coat. Local contractors can handle these steps to achieve a desired look.
Can staining change the color of existing cabinetry? Yes, staining can alter the color of existing cabinetry, providing a darker, richer, or more uniform appearance. Service providers can recommend the best stain options for specific wood types.
Is staining suitable for all types of wood cabinetry? Staining works well on most wood types, but some woods may absorb stain differently. Local pros can assess the cabinetry to determine the best staining approach.
What are the benefits of staining built-in cabinetry? Staining can enhance the natural beauty of wood, provide a uniform appearance, and protect the surface. Local contractors can help achieve a durable and attractive finish.
How should I prepare my cabinetry for staining? Preparation may involve cleaning, sanding, and sometimes filling imperfections. Experienced service providers can prepare the surfaces properly for optimal staining results.
